Peter BLOOD was born in 1774 in Dunstable, Middlesex, Massachusetts, USA, the child of Robert Blood Sr And Thankful Blood. In 1830, Peter BLOOD resided in Putney, Windham, Vermont, USA. Peter BLOOD married Jane Jennie Willson, and had children including Charles Blood, Jane Blood, John Blood, Louisa Blood, Paulina Blood, Peter Blood. Peter BLOOD passed away in 1840 in Putney, Windham County, Vermont, United States of America.
